JavaShuo
栏目
标签
如何理解算法时间复杂度的表示法O(n²)、O(n)、O(1)、O(nlogn)等?
时间 2021-01-01
原文
原文链接
时间复杂度这个东西,其实更准确点说应该是描述一个算法在问题规模不断增大时对应的时间增长曲线。所以,这些增长数量级并不是一个准确的性能评价,可以理解为一个近似值,时间的增长近似于logN、NlogN的曲线。 先从O(1)来说,理论上哈希表就是O(1)。因为哈希表是通过哈希函数来映射的,所以拿到一个关键字,用哈希函数转换一下,就可以直接从表中取出对应的值。和现存数据有多少毫无关系,故而
>>阅读原文<<
相关文章
1.
如何理解算法时间复杂度的表示
2.
算法复杂度分析,算法复杂度o(1), o(n), o(logn), o(nlogn) 时间复杂度On和空间复杂度O1是什么意思?
3.
理解算法的时间复杂度
4.
算法的时间复杂度理解
5.
算法的时间复杂度示例
6.
算法时间复杂度理解
7.
大O时间复杂度表示法
8.
算法的时间复杂度和空间复杂度详解
9.
算法的时间复杂度(大O表示法)
10.
算法复杂度:时间复杂度和空间复杂度
更多相关文章...
•
XSD 如何使用?
-
XML Schema 教程
•
SQLite 日期 & 时间
-
SQLite教程
•
算法总结-广度优先算法
•
算法总结-深度优先算法
相关标签/搜索
join..on
join....on
join......on
join...on
zsh+on
on+iss
On Lisp
on...whe
示法
算法复习
Spring教程
PHP教程
PHP 7 新特性
算法
调度
计算
0
分享到微博
分享到微信
分享到QQ
每日一句
每一个你不满意的现在,都有一个你没有努力的曾经。
最新文章
1.
《给初学者的Windows Vista的补遗手册》之074
2.
CentoOS7.5下编译suricata-5.0.3及简单使用
3.
快速搭建网站
4.
使用u^2net打造属于自己的remove-the-background
5.
3.1.7 spark体系之分布式计算-scala编程-scala中模式匹配match
6.
小Demo大知识-通过控制Button移动来学习Android坐标
7.
maya检查和删除多重面
8.
Java大数据:大数据开发必须掌握的四种数据库
9.
强烈推荐几款IDEA插件,12款小白神器
10.
数字孪生体技术白皮书 附下载地址
本站公众号
欢迎关注本站公众号,获取更多信息
相关文章
1.
如何理解算法时间复杂度的表示
2.
算法复杂度分析,算法复杂度o(1), o(n), o(logn), o(nlogn) 时间复杂度On和空间复杂度O1是什么意思?
3.
理解算法的时间复杂度
4.
算法的时间复杂度理解
5.
算法的时间复杂度示例
6.
算法时间复杂度理解
7.
大O时间复杂度表示法
8.
算法的时间复杂度和空间复杂度详解
9.
算法的时间复杂度(大O表示法)
10.
算法复杂度:时间复杂度和空间复杂度
>>更多相关文章<<